Bearing Material

Rings(cups & cones) & Rolling elements
SFT bearing rings(cups & cones), balls & rollers are made of GCr15 high carbon chromium bearing steel
This steel No. is equal to the AISI 52100(U.S.A.), DIN 100Cr6(Germany), JIS SUJ2(Japan) etc.

Hardness
Hardness of bearing rings(cups & cones) & rolling elements is HRC60
HRC65.

Retainers
SFT standard bearing retainers are made from cold rolled carbon steel. However, in cases of heavy duty, corrosive environment,misalignment and high speed operation, brass, stainless steel, nylon or phenolic resins will be used upon request.

Seals & Shields
SFT shields also employ carbon steel as standard.
Buna Nitrile is the standard and mostly common used material for SFT seals. Also, in order to meet the requirements of high temperature operation and compatibility with grease, a variety of other sealing materials are also applied to the seals.

Lubrication
Standard grease and oil are applied to SFT bearing products
SFT can also use special pointed brand grease or oil upon request

Tolerance

SFT bearing tolerance standard accords with Chinese national standard GB/T307(equal to ISO492)

Clearance

SFT bearing radial clearance accords with the Chinese national standard GB/T 4604,
which is equal to ISO 5753

The clearances is classified into 5 groups, C2, C0, C3, C4, C5 with different applications
depending on customer's request

Vibration & Noise

Bearing vibration means bearing components' elastic deformation that varies with time and all other
movement that deviates from a theoretic position except that necessary to bearing functions.
It has two modes-acceleration (dB) and velocity (um/s).
Vibration acceleration is examined according to Z, Z1, Z2, Z3 values. Grade Z is fundamental.
Z1, Z2, Z3 successively indicate the vibration level ranging from low to high.  
Vibration velocity is examined as per V, V1, V2 and V3. Grade V is fundamental,
V1, V2, V3 successively indicate the vibration level ranging from low to high.
